The Chinese government 's response to most accusations of not doing enough to stamp out this illegal trade has been to set up more bodies or reshuffle the existing ones dealing with the anti piracy issues . Mertha 's argument is that the setting up of so many bodies has fragmented the war with so many bodies...

The proposed implementation of Distance Education allows teachers to be trained in an efficient manner without the need to sacrifice quality . In turn , this will lead to the improvement of the quality of teachers employed in primary and secondary schools (Robinson , 2008 . Another deterrent in the provision of basic education in the Gansu province is the lack of funding . As stated earlier , more than half of the population in this area very poor and live below the poverty line . In...
